Ireland, Dublin, Deserted Children, 1849-1854

This collection was created from a report made to the House of Commons about deserted children who were taken into the care of the Dublin Metropolitan Police Force between 1849-1854. The report contained the names and ages of the children (if known) and where they were found. This collection was provided in coordination with FindMyPast.

What is in This Collection?

This publication accounts for about 500 children taken into the care of the Dublin Metropolitan Police Force in the years ending 30th June 1850 to 1854. It is taken from a Return made to the House of Commons in July 1854.

Additional records and/or images may be added to this collection in the future.

What Can These Records Tell Me?

The following information may be found in these records:

  • Person's name
  • Age
  • Where they were found
  • Date taken into care
